IS WHAT I SAY DURING MY TREATMENT CONFIDENTIAL?
Confidentiality is a respected part of psychology's code of ethics. Therapists understand that for people to feel comfortable talking about private and revealing information, they need a safe place to talk about anything they'd like, without fear of that information leaving the room.

CAN I BRING FAMILY MEMBERS OR FRIENDS TO TREATMENT?
Family sessions are a type of counseling that can help family members improve communication and resolve conflicts. During a family therapy session, therapists may talk with the family as a group, as individuals, or as a combination of the two. A typical therapy session is around 50 minutes long, per clinical necessity, and with a signed Release of Information Agreement with the client.
